Statement war disgusting, says Shivashankarappa

Staff Correspondent

DAVANGERE: Shyamanur Shivashankarappa, Davangere MLA and treasurer of the Karnataka Pradesh Congress Committee (KPCC), on Tuesday took exception to the statement war between the Congress and the Janata Dal (Secular). He said the quarrel between the two coalition partners is disgusting.

The MLA was inaugurating roadworks here on Tuesday. He said he did not understand why his party continued in the coalition when leaders of the Janata Dal (Secular) criticised all top leaders of the Congress.

Mr. Shivashankarappa said the Government said every MLA will be allocated Rs. 50 lakhs for taking up development work in his constituency. But it has not kept its promise. Even after 11 months, the Government has not built a single Ashraya house, he alleged.
